Academic Education Specialist Training
This post was set up in 2005 as a joint initiative between St Michaels Hospital and the University of Bristol. The post is open to national competition, attracts an NTN and is recognised for training in obstetrics and gynaecology towards CCT. The postholder undertakes general advanced training in Obstetrics and Gynaecology but is given the additional opportunity to develop skills in the field of teaching and learning specifically in Undergraduate Education. The postholder is expected to undertake the ATSM in Medical Education unless they already hold a teaching qualification. The supervising consultant is Mr David Cahill (Head of Academic Obstetrics and Gynaecology). This post was last appointed in June 2008.
